The Overall Health Score in 02650, North Chatham, Massachusetts is 92 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
78.95 percent of the population in 02650 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 100.00 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 0.00 percent of the residents in 02650 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.01 members with about 2.00 cars available per household.
An estimate of 84.42 percent of the residents in 02650 has some form of health insurance. 42.67 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 64.40 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 02650 would have to travel an average of 15.52 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Cape Cod Healthcare . In a 20-mile radius, there are 346 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 02650, North Chatham, Massachusetts.

As of , an estimate of 764 residents live in 02650 with a median age of 66.6 years. 3.66 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 51.83 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 32.98 percent of the residents in 02650 is currently married, and 10.99 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 02650 is $7,155.42.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 02650 is approximately $3,361. The median household spends about 46.97 percent of their income on housing.
